The Global Student Entrepreneur Awards (GSEA) will host a live competition in India. The winning student entrepreneur will advance to the 2010 GSEA Global Finals in Kansas City, USA.
The first step for eligible undergraduate student entrepreneurs from India is to submit their nomination on our Web site at www.gsea.org/nominate. Once a student is nominated they will receive a confirmation e-mail and a link to the detailed online application. The online application must be completed in full and submitted before the 2010 application deadline for India.
The application deadline for India is 15 September 2010.

The GSEA has regional supporters who operate the competition and liaison with local university contacts, entrepreneurs, media and more to facilitate the success of the program in the region. Each year the GSEA recognizes these key Entrepreneurs’ Organization (EO) Members as ‘GSEA Champions.’
We are proud to recognize Entrepreneurs’ Organization Member Shamit Khemka as the 2010 GSEA supporter in India.

Shamit is the Founder and MD at SynapseIndia, a company which offers offshore web and software application development, online marketing, mobile application development and web design solutions that help small and medium-scale businesses to perform, profit, and grow.
